First Phase of the capital increase has been successfully completed: Retail Estates announces the results of the capital increase in cash within the framework of the authorized capital with irrevocable allocation right after the closing of the subscription period - launch of the accelerated private placement.

The subscription period with irrevocable allocation right closed on 23 April 2018. During the subscription period 1,669,426 New Shares were subscribed to, through the exercise of irrevocable allocation rights (5 irrevocable allocation rights gave the right to subscribe to 1 new share) at a subscription price of EUR 65.00 (inclusive of coupon no. 26 representing the right to the annual dividend for the financial year 2017/2018, for which a dividend prognosis of EUR 3.60 gross per share is made and with regard to which the annual meeting of Retail Estates scheduled for 23 July 2018 will decide) per New Share. This represents a subscription to 87.96% of the maximum number of new shares offered.

The 1,142,530 irrevocable allocation rights that have not been exercised during the subscription period, shall be converted to an equal amount of scrips that will be sold in an exempted private placement in the form of an "accelerated bookbuilding" or accelerated private placement with the composition of an order book, implemented in Belgium, Switzerland and the European Economic Area, as set forth in point 8.1.3 of the Prospectus. This exempted private placement will occur on 25 April 2018, immediately after the publication of this press release.

The investors acquiring these scrips, irrevocably undertake to subscribe to the remaining new shares, subject to the same conditions as those for the subscription with irrevocable allocation rights: namely 1 new share (at EUR 65.00 per new share) for 5 irrevocable allocation rights in the form of scrips. The net proceeds of the sale of these scrips (The "Excess Amount") shall be paid upon presentation of coupon no. 25, in principle as from 30 April 2018. However, if the Excess Amount divided by the total number of scrips is less than EUR 0.01, it will not be distributed to the holders of non-exercised irrevocable allocation rights, but will instead be transferred and accrued to Retail Estates.

The new shares participate in the result of Retail Estates in the same way as the existing shares. Therefore, their holders are entitled to the full dividend (if any) for the financial year 2017/2018, which started on 1 April 2017 and ended on 31 March 2018 (and for which a dividend prognosis of EUR 3.60 gross per share is envisaged), as well as for the current financial year 2018/2019, which started on 1 April 2018 and will end on 31 March 2019.

On 25 April 2018, trading in the share on the regulated markets of Euronext Brussels and Euronext Amsterdam shall, at Retail Estates' request, be suspended as of market opening and this until the announcement of the results of the transaction (i.e., the results of the offering with irrevocable allocation rights, combined with the results of the exempted private placement of the scrips).

The results of the transactions, the subscription to the new shares with irrevocable allocation rights and with scrips, as well as the result of the sale of the scrips and the Excess Amount that (in the occurring event) shall accrue to the holders of non-exercised irrevocable allocation rights , shall be announced on 25 April 2018 by way of a new press release.

The delivery and payment of the new shares is foreseen on 27 April 2018. In principle, the new shares will be admitted to trading on the Euronext Brussels regulated market as of the same date.

ABOUT RETAIL ESTATES NV

Retail Estates nv is a public regulated real estate company and more specifically a niche company that specialises in investing in out-of-town retail properties which are located on the periphery of residential areas or along main access roads into urban centres. Retail Estates nv buys these properties from third parties or builds and markets retail buildings for its own account. The buildings have useful areas ranging between 500m² and 3,000m². A typical retail building has an average area of 1,000m².

On 31 December 2017, Retail Estates nv has 809 properties in its portfolio with a lettable surface of 978,328m². The occupancy rate of the portfolio was 98.32% on 31 December 2017, compared to 98.13% on 31 March 2017.

The fair value of the consolidated real estate portfolio of Retail Estates nv at 31 December 2017 is estimated by independent real estate experts at EUR 1,329.13 million.

Retail Estates nv is listed on Euronext Brussels and Euronext Amsterdam and is registered as a public regulated real estate company. On 31 December 2017, the stock market capitalisation of its shares amounts to EUR 690.56 million.
